
High Salary: Environmental Health
2 weeks ago
We are currently seeking an experienced and proactive EHS Lead to join a high-performing manufacturing company.
If you have strong communication skills, a background in safety leadership, and thrive in fast-paced environments, this is an ideal opportunity to make an impact and drive high standards across the site.
Reporting directly into senior leadership, you'll manage day-to-day EHS activities and lead a small team of two, ensuring the site maintains its commitment to safety, compliance, and continuous improvement. This position requires someone who can hit the ground running and confidently take the reins of a well-established safety function.
Location: Naas, Co. Kildare
Salary: €60,000–€65,000 per annum
Employment Type: Full-Time | Permanent
Key Responsibilities:
Lead the daily operations of the EHS department.
Manage and mentor a team of two EHS professionals.
Review and update risk assessments, safety procedures, work instructions, and the site's safety statement.
Monitor safety metrics and incidents; present daily safety performance stats to operations.
Investigate and document accidents, incidents, and near-misses; implement corrective actions.
Oversee internal audits, inspections, and follow-ups across departments.
Identify opportunities for proactive safety improvements and support site-wide initiatives.
Prepare for and support regulatory audits and compliance reviews.
Coordinate and maintain all EHS training requirements and schedules, updating training matrices accordingly.
Deliver toolbox talks, safety alerts, and site-wide EHS communications.
Oversee emergency preparedness programs, including fire safety, hazardous materials, and vehicle safety.
Manage contractor safety processes in collaboration with the engineering team.
Required Qualifications & Experience:
Level 8 qualification in Health & Safety or a related field is required.
Proven experience managing a team and driving a safety-first culture.
1–3 years' experience in an EHS role within a manufacturing or high-risk environment.
Strong understanding of safety legislation and compliance standards.
Certifications in Manual Handling Instruction, Occupational First Aid, and Train-the-Trainer (desirable).
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
Strong attention to detail with solid reporting and administrative abilities.
Proficient in Microsoft Office and familiar with EHS software platforms.
Confident, professional, and capable of engaging and influencing stakeholders at all levels.
